Material Prep Work Methods
Reliable manufacturing of HDPE pipelines starts with careful material preparation strategies, particularly the extrusion process. During this stage, high-density polyethylene resin is initial dried out to get rid of wetness, making certain optimal flow features. The resin is after that fed right into the extruder, where it goes through heating and melting, changing into a thick state. This heating procedure is carefully regulated to maintain the product's integrity and performance. The liquified HDPE is compelled through a die, shaping it into a constant pipeline form. Correct temperature monitoring throughout extrusion is crucial, as it directly affects the product's properties and the final product high quality. When shaped, the HDPE pipeline is cooled and reduced to specified lengths, prepared for subsequent handling and applications.

Top Quality Control Procedures in HDPE Manufacturing
Although various elements affect the high quality of HDPE pipe production, efficient top quality control procedures are important to guarantee consistency and reliability in the final item. Secret quality assurance practices consist of rigorous material inspection, confirming that the raw polyethylene fulfills well-known standards for purity and thickness. Throughout the extrusion procedure, criteria such as temperature level, pressure, and cooling time are very closely monitored to maintain dimensional precision and structural stability
Additionally, post-production screening is necessary; makers usually carry out hydrostatic examinations to examine the pipe's stamina and resistance to stress. Aesthetic examinations for surface area issues better boost quality control. Certification from relevant standards organizations, like ASTM or ISO, gives an additional layer of reliability. By implementing these comprehensive top quality control measures, makers can decrease defects, enhance efficiency, and ensure that the HDPE pipes fulfill the specific requirements of various applications, inevitably resulting in client fulfillment and rely on the item.

Agricultural Irrigation Networks
Agricultural watering networks profit substantially from making use of high-density polyethylene (HDPE) pipelines, which provide efficient and trusted water shipment to crops. HDPE pipelines are lightweight, making them simple to deliver and mount, while their flexibility enables numerous setups in varied terrains. These pipes demonstrate exceptional resistance to rust, chemicals, and UV radiation, making sure longevity in rough farming environments. Furthermore, their smooth interior surface minimizes friction loss, optimizing water flow and minimizing power costs related to pumping. The durability of HDPE pipes, commonly surpassing 50 years, adds to lower maintenance and substitute costs. Farmers significantly count on HDPE pipelines to improve irrigation performance and promote lasting farming techniques, eventually leading to boosted crop yields and source conservation.
